Open up your yum.conf file. Take a look at your repositories. If
freshrpms.net isn't in there, and I can surmise it probably isn't, go to
freshrpms.net, and get yum for yellow dog. Do a rpm -Uvh yum.rpm and
then do a yum upgrade.
If xine comes with Yellow Dog it most certainly lacks DVD playback
because of legal issues. MPlayer with DVD support is also in the
freshrpms.net repository.
